The Belt and Road Initiative, frequently abbreviated as BRI, has actually come to be one of the most widely talked about global participation structures of the 21st century. For many readers, the BRI is more than a polite expression or a financial program; it is a wide vision for constructing networks that link Asia, Europe, Africa, and beyond. Since the BRI is usually talked about in political, financial, and tactical terms, fundamental descriptions are beneficial for target markets that desire to understand what it actually implies, how it functions, and why it matters.
At its core, the BRI has to do with teamwork rather than independent advancement. The initiative stresses common benefits, open connection, and shared learning amongst participating nations. It is not a single project or a fixed establishment, however rather a structure under which numerous tasks and collaborations can be developed. These can consist of roadways, trains, ports, power grids, telecommunications networks, commercial parks, custom-mades facilitation, electronic trade platforms, and instructional exchanges. In method, the BRI is adaptable enough to include both large physical facilities and smaller sized but still meaningful forms of collaboration. This adaptability is one factor the effort has broadened across a variety of regions and fields. Some nations sign up with because they require transport framework to improve trade. Others want financial investment, work production, market access, or technology transfer. Still others are drawn to the wider concept of enhancing regional interdependence and economic durability. The BRI's charm lies partly in this ability to support development priorities that vary from nation to nation while still fitting within a common structure of cooperation.

Because language matters in worldwide initiatives, the concern of main English translation is also essential. The name "Belt and Road Initiative" is the well-known English translation of the Chinese phrase that refers to the Silk Road Economic Belt and the 21st-Century Maritime Silk Road. This translation has come to be standard in worldwide discussion, journalism, scholastic writing, and polite interaction. Making use of a regular English term helps in reducing confusion and sustains Chinese Enterprise news more clear conversation concerning the campaign's scope and purpose. It is likewise a tip that the BRI is indicated for an international target market and must be communicated across linguistic and cultural boundaries. In international collaboration, terminology can shape perception, so the main translation plays a function in exactly how the effort is comprehended abroad.
